Get the rent paid.
That has been the unwavering stance of KC Regional Housing Alliance President Stacey Johnson-Cosby from the beginning of the pandemic and throughout the resulting rental crisis.
In December 2020, Congress allocated $25 billion for emergency rental assistance. About $600 million of that money has now made its way to Kansas and Missouri. The KC Regional Housing Alliance is working with United Way and other organizations to show renters and landlords how to access these funds for themselves.

KANSAS CITY, Mo. — The United Way of Greater Kansas City is letting people know if they're having difficulty paying bills this winter, there's help.
Arctic cold plunged temperatures into the single digits and below zero during a two-week period in early and mid-February.
As a result of the dangerous cold, heat in many homes stayed on or was increased for an extended period of time.
Todd Jordan with the United Way of Greater Kansas City said the first step for anyone looking for help is to call 211 or visit the United Way of Greater Kansas City's website.
